Abstract: A clutch assembly attachable to a rotational output shaft of the engine, wherein the clutch assembly is configured to drive at least one implement of a lawn maintenance vehicle is provided. The clutch assembly includes a first pulley fixedly attached to the output shaft, a second pulley independently rotatable relative to the first pulley, and a belt extending between the first and second pulleys and an idler pulley that is movable between an engaged position and a disengaged position. The clutch assembly further includes a third pulley directly connected with the second pulley, wherein rotation of the second pulley is directly transferred to the third pulley, and rotation of the third pulley provides an output rotation of the clutch assembly.

Abstract: A zone mobility system and method for an autonomous device includes a work area within which the autonomous device is intended to operate, one or more electrically separated boundary conductors, each boundary conductor surrounding a work zone within the work area, a transmitter base electrically connected to at least one of the boundary conductors, and a removably coupled transmitter configured to transmit a signal for directing movement of the autonomous device on the boundary conductor wire. The transmitted signal can be adjusted to optimize the power consumption of the transmitter, and a work operation can be commenced utilizing a transmitter interface, and/or utilizing an autonomous device user interface.

Abstract: A caster wheel assembly for an outdoor power equipment machine includes a wheel mount and provides a double bell-shaped caster wheel including two bell-shaped halves, each bell-shaped half includes a central hub, a smooth transition portion, an outer circumferential rim, and a planar face. A ground contacting tread can be provided by the outer circumferential rims. A ground contacting tread can be provided by a resilient tread ring positioned between the two bell-shaped halves.

Abstract: A high-efficiency cutting system for an autonomous mower provides a multiple blade tip cutting radius for a cleaner cut, and more complete mow. The system includes a spinning blade disk provided within a housing including a vertical standoff. The blade disk includes a first pair of cutting blades located between the center of the blade disk and the circumference of the blade disk, and a second pair of cutting blades located radially inward from the first pair of cutting blades. The cutting blades extend downward and away from the blade disk at an angle.

Abstract: A three-stage snow thrower having a housing, a power supply operatively connected to said housing, a longitudinal drive shaft extending from the power supply into the housing, and a lateral drive shaft extending rotatably attached to opposing side walls of the housing and being meshingly engaged with the longitudinal drive shaft within a gear assembly. The power supply drives the longitudinal drive shaft, thereby causing the longitudinal drive shaft to rotate, and at least a portion of such rotation is transferred to the lateral drive via a gear assembly. The first stage assembly includes a plurality of augers attached to the lateral drive shaft, wherein the first stage assembly pushes loosened snow axially toward the gear assembly. The second stage assembly includes at least one auger attached to the longitudinal drive shaft, wherein the second stage assembly pushes the snow from the first stage assembly axially rearward in a transverse manner relative to the first stage assembly. The third stage assembly includes an impeller that rotates to throw the snow from the second stage assembly through a chute attached to the housing to expel the snow from the housing.
